An image forming apparatus including: an image bearing member; an electrifying unit for electrifying the image bearing member at a contact portion in order to form an electrostatic image on the image bearing member, a voltage, in which a direct-current voltage and an alternating-current voltage are superimposed on each other, being applied to the electrifying unit; and a developing unit for developing the electrostatic image on the image bearing member using toner; where after a toner image on the image bearing member is transferred onto a transferring medium, residual toner residing on the image bearing member is carried to the contact portion in accordance with rotation of the image bearing member, and a peak to peak voltage of the alternating-current voltage applied to the electrifying unit in order to discharge the residual toner adhering to the electrifying unit to the image bearing member during a certain period of non-image forming is set so as to be higher than a peak to peak voltage applied during image forming.
